My CPU is limited by my current graphics card (gtx 940m) so it can only reach about 70%.
What is the best graphics card that can maximise my CPU usage without being hindered by it?
 
This is a Laptop you can't just replace the GPU so easily but you have a few options.

1. Look into an eGPU provided you have the ports to run it. An eGPU is a GPU/Enclosure and Power supply that sits on your desk and plugs into the laptop via a Thunderbolt 3 port or USB 3.1 port. Prices will look something like this.

1060 6gb used $120
970 GTX Used $80
Enclosure and adapter card $120
Power Supply $50
Cable $10

There are name brand premade units that will start out at around $279 with a 1050 GTX.

2. Replacing the chip entirely, this is expensive since your going to need to find someone to micro solder and the chip itself. Prices will look something like this.

980M $320+ "Hard to find at a reasonable price"
970M $210+ " Hard to find"
960M $120+ " Hard to find"
Replacement internal Cooler $35 " Hard to find depending on model"
Micro soldering $75-$125 for the labor + Shipping of the unit to and back.
Upgraded power adapter if you're running a 95W or lower $35.

3. Reduce your settings and resolution or just replace the laptop.
